WebWhen you leave the cycle selection to the dishwasher, it adjusts the time duration according to sensor readings. It will fix the time based on how heavy the load is and how dirty the dishes are. On average, dishwasher cycles take anywhere between 1.5 and 4 hours. The exact duration will depend on the chosen setting and the temperature and water ...

WebCycle time is anywhere from 1.5 to 4 hours long depending on the cycle and options selected. Some models are equipped with an optical sensor wash that detects water temperature, soil and detergent amount. Wash cycles are then adjusted based on what is sensed. When loads are overly dirty, the optical sensor will default to the longest cycle …
